1樓:陳說教育
1,des(data encryption standard):對稱演算法,資料加密標準,速度較快,適用於加密大量資料的場合。
2,3des(triple des):是基於des的對稱演算法,對一塊資料用三個不同的金鑰進行三次加密,強度更高。
3,rc2和rc4:對稱演算法,用變長金鑰對大量資料進行加密,比 des 快。
4,idea(international data encryption algorithm)國際資料加密演算法,使用 128 位金鑰提供非常強的安全性。
5,rsa:由 rsa 公司發明,是一個支援變長金鑰的公共金鑰演算法,需要加密的檔案塊的長度也是可變的,非對稱演算法。
2樓:冰凌東揚
可逆的就是能加密又能解密的吧,像rsa/des/3des/aes/sm4等都是能夠加解密的。加密之後用金鑰能解密回明文。
3樓:匿名使用者
des, aes, rsa
4樓:匿名使用者
第一是異或 用的是一種二進位制的基本操作
第二是移位 將一個字母唯一地替換為另一個字母 比如後移動一位 把a換成b....z換成a
這兩種可逆
還有是hash 不過不可逆
常用的對稱加密演算法有哪些?
5樓:
對稱加密演算法用來對敏感資料等資訊進行加密,常用的演算法包括:
des(data encryption standard):資料加密標準,速度較快,適用於加密大量資料的場合。
3des(triple des):是基於des,對一塊資料用三個不同的金鑰進行三次加密,強度更高。
對稱加密演算法:
對稱加密演算法是應用較早的加密演算法,技術成熟。在對稱加密演算法中,資料發信方將明文(原始資料)和加密金鑰(mi yue)一起經過特殊加密演算法處理後,使其變成複雜的加密密文傳送出去。
基於C語言的DES加密演算法的實現要怎麼寫啊
首先c語言要熟悉,然後去圖書館借一本加密解密的書,要裡面有c語言des實現 的 這種書是有的,我看到過 先對加密解密的歷史及發展現狀進行介紹,然後著重對des加密的發展歷史及原理進行闡述 以上內容要多借幾本相關書綜合一下用自己的語言表達出來 然後對des的演算法寫個程式 可以利用書裡面的程式 然後執...
求c具體的3des雙倍加密演算法跪求
using system using system.collections.generic using system.linq using system.text using system.io using system.security.cryptography namespace rare.ca...
求矩陣特徵值有哪些常用數值的演算法
求矩陣的特徵值就 使用 a e 0計算 如果是實對稱矩陣 那麼特徵值是一定可以算出來的 實際上就是化簡行列式的過程 如何計算矩陣特徵值 設此矩陣a的特徵值為 則 a e 1 0 0 1 1 3 3 第1行減去第3行乘以 0 1 3 2 3 0 1 1 3 3 按第1列展回開 1 3 2 3 答3 3...